Autor: Firefox user 13593688, 7 lat temuThis is super useful extension. I use it a lot.
Some suggestions for improvements:
* Allow possibility to "ignore" some open tab so it's not taken into consideration when checking for duplicates.
I had one or two situations when it would be useful (filters we not enough).
So for example when you have "duplicate tabs" list you could right click and choose "Ignore duplicate checking for this tab" (or some other better text) and this entry on "duplicate list" would get different colour or be in italic to indicate that we ignored this page. We could then click again and uncheck this option.
When tab is ignored then we don't see number that we have duplicate for it and "Close all duplicate tabs" won't close this tab.
* I have no idea what this "pin" do on different option sections ("Priority", "Filter", etc). Maybe have some hover over text that explain what it does
* Make this extension open source - this is of course you personal choice to keep it private. I just think it would be awesome and help improving this great extension even more.

Data: 7 lat temuYour first request is something I know as I also need to duplicate tabs. :)
I'll work on something after the whitelist feature.
About the "Priority", "Filter", etc I've tried to explain this in the description of the add-on.
Filters allows to define how you want to compare the tabs.
Priority allows to define which tabs to not close.
I'll move the code on GitHub, just to have time.
Thanks for the review.
